West Virginia Code § 15-9B-5

Offenses; penalty

Any person who willfully neglects or refuses to do or perform any duty imposed by this
article is guilty of a misdemeanor and, upon conviction, shall be fined not less than $50 nor
more than $200, or be confined in jail for a period of not more than 60 days, or both fined
and confined.
